Since its release in 1999, Counter-Strike has been a cornerstone of the esports scene, pioneering competitive gameplay that has shaped the entire landscape of online gaming. The first major tournament, the World Cyber Games in 2001, showcased the potential of Counter-Strike as a spectator sport, drawing in thousands of fans and offering substantial prize pools. Over the years, tournaments such as ESL One and DreamHack have pushed the boundaries of esports, not only through advanced production values but also by introducing new monetization models that other games would later adopt. These events have established a high standard for competitive integrity, gameplay skill, and viewer engagement, making Counter-Strike synonymous with esports excellence.
The influence of Counter-Strike tournaments extends beyond just gameplay; they have fostered a vibrant community that has embraced Twitch streams, YouTube content, and even cross-platform events. As the game evolved, so did its tournament structure, transitioning from local LAN events to global championships that feature the best teams from around the world. This growth has inspired a multitude of esports titles to adopt similar competitive frameworks, enabling gamers to pursue professional careers. Furthermore, the legacy of Counter-Strike tournaments has led to important conversations about game balance, teamwork, and the role of digital sports in mainstream culture, cementing its status as a key player in the overall evolution of esports.
The Counter-Strike Championships serve as a pinnacle where individual skill and team dynamics converge to create a high-stakes competitive environment. Players are tested not only on their reaction times and aim but also on how well they execute strategies under pressure. The game demands a deep understanding of maps, weapon mechanics, and opponent behavior, requiring players to think on their feet. As champions rise and fall, it becomes evident that mere marksmanship isn't sufficient; strategic planning and communication between teammates play critical roles in securing victory.
In Counter-Strike Championships, the ability to adapt is just as crucial as raw talent. Teams must react to their opponents' strategies in real time, making split-second decisions that can change the course of a match. A successful team will create layered tactics, blending aggressive assaults with defensive setups, often employing strategies such as smokes and flashes to gain advantageous positions. This intricate blend of skill and strategy elevates Counter-Strike far beyond a simple shooting game, transforming it into a captivating spectacle where mental acuity and teamwork determine who ultimately triumphs.
